摘 要:对某船用中速柴油机的电控化改造前按推进特性进行了排放试验。试验分析结果表明:该机低转速、低负荷区CO排放浓度低,HC排放浓度高,而高转速高负荷区CO排放浓度高,HC排放浓度低;NOx排放浓度最高位于800r/min附近,而NOx比排放随转速和负荷的升高而降低,其变化趋势主要受油耗率的影响。试验结果可供相关技术人员参考。The emission test of a marine medium speed diesel engine against the propulsion characteristics is carried out before its transformation to electronic control. Test results show that the CO emission is low and the HC emis- sion is high in the condition of low speed and low load, while the CO emission is high and the HC emissions is low in the condition of high speed and heavy load; the highest NOx emission appears at a speed of about 800 rpm. The NOx specific emission decreases as the engine speed and load increase within operating range and under brake, and its var- iation trend is mainly influenced by fueI consumption rate.
